PVDF Pipe

PVDF Pipe

PVDF (polyvinylidene fluoride) pipe is a thermoplastic piping system made from polyvinylidene fluoride, a high-performance material known for its excellent chemical resistance, mechanical strength and thermal stability.

How long will PVDF Pipe last outside​?

PVDF pipe has excellent UV resistance and durability, so it can last 20 to 30 years or more outdoors. However, factors such as extreme temperatures, chemical exposure and maintenance can affect its service life. Proper installation and occasional maintenance can help extend its life.

Can you glue PVDF Pipe​?

Yes, PVDF pipe can be bonded using solvent cement or fusion welding. Special solvent cements designed for PVDF form a strong bond, while fusion welding provides a longer lasting, seamless joint. Ordinary PVC adhesives will not work.

PVDF Pipe Sizes​

PVDF pipe is typically available in diameters from 1/4‘ to 24’. Custom sizes are also available depending on the application.

PVDF Pipe Temperature Rating​

PVDF pipes typically have a temperature rating of -40°C to 150°C (-40°F to 302°F). However, they can withstand short-term exposure to higher temperatures, up to 180°C (356°F), without significant performance degradation.

PVDF Pipe Installation​

PVDF piping installation typically involves the following steps:

  1. Preparation

– Make sure the work area is clean and dry.

– Cut the pipe to the required length using a pipe cutter or saw designed for plastics.

  1. Joining Method

– Solvent Adhesive: For small to medium diameters, use a solvent adhesive designed for PVDF to bond the pipe and fittings together.

– Fusion welding: For larger diameters or stronger bonds, use fusion welding to fuse the pipe and fittings together.

  1. Support and Alignment

– Properly support pipe during installation to avoid sagging or stressing of joints.

– Use proper hangers or brackets to secure pipe along length of pipe.

  1. Testing

– After installation, perform pressure and leakage tests to ensure that all joints are secure and the system is functioning properly.

  1. UV Protection (if installed outdoors)

– If the pipe is exposed to sunlight for an extended period of time, consider applying a UV-protective coating or insulation.

Proper installation ensures that PVDF piping will perform well and provide long-term durability and reliability.
